This year's Easter Bunny Train services have been cancelled.
Groudle Glen Railway says following careful consideration of the current situation and advice from the government, the services have been cancelled.
The event was due to take place on Easter Sunday and Monday.
Groudle Glen says it understand it will be a huge disappointment to many, but ultimately we want to protect the health and safety of everyone using the Railway and the wider community.
